我们的服务已触达

全中国及海外20多个国家

中国

北京、上海、深圳、广州、香港、成都、重庆、杭州、武汉、西安、天津、苏州、南京、郑州、长沙、东莞、沈阳、青岛、合肥、佛山、山东、台湾、苏州、厦门...

海外

俄罗斯、美国、加拿大、新加坡、日本、韩国、法国、英国、德国、意大利、澳大利亚、沙特阿拉伯、新西兰、荷兰、以色列、越南...

合作咨询 400-890-9080

请通过表单提交合作咨询信息,我们会尽快与您取得联系。

创造有活力的品牌网站 提升用户体验和品牌价值感

Vue开发教程:打造响应式网站的步骤与技巧

人气 138

Vue开发教程:打造响应式网站的步骤与技巧

制作响应式网站的需求与挑战

随着移动设备的普及和互联网的高速发展,响应式网站已经成为了现代网页设计的基本要求。响应式网站能够根据不同设备和屏幕尺寸的特点,自动适应并呈现最佳的用户体验。但是,制作一个响应式网站也面临着一些挑战,比如兼容性、性能优化等。本文将以Vue作为开发框架,为您介绍制作响应式网站的步骤与技巧。

Vue简介与概念理解

Vue是一款轻量级的JavaScript框架,可用于构建用户界面。它的设计目标是提供一种简单、灵活的方式来管理用户界面的状态和交互。Vue采用了声明式的渲染方式,并且具备了响应式和组件化的特点,使得开发者能够更加高效地开发复杂的前端应用。

步骤一:搭建Vue开发环境

在开始开发之前,我们需要先搭建好Vue的开发环境。首先,您需要安装Node.js和npm,它们将作为我们开发过程中的工具和依赖管理器。接下来,您可以使用npm全局安装Vue脚手架工具,通过命令行创建一个新的Vue项目。完成这些步骤后,我们就可以开始编写代码了。

步骤二:设计并创建网站的整体布局

在设计响应式网站之前,我们需要先确定网站的整体布局,包括页面结构、导航栏、侧边栏等。这些布局元素应该能够适应不同屏幕大小的设备,并提供良好的用户体验。在Vue中,我们可以通过使用Vue的组件化特性来划分和管理网站的不同部分,以便更好地实现页面布局和内容重用。

步骤三:制作响应式的组件

响应式组件是构建响应式网站的核心。Vue通过数据绑定和响应式的特性,能够实时地更新组件的状态和界面。在制作响应式组件时,我们需要关注组件的尺寸和样式,以便在不同的设备上呈现最佳的用户体验。同时,我们还可以使用Vue的过渡效果和动画特性,为网站增添更多的交互效果。

为什么选择Vue开发响应式网站?

Vue.js是一个流行的JavaScript框架,被广泛用于构建现代化的网站和应用程序。它具有简洁的语法和强大的功能,使开发者能够轻松创建出优雅、高性能的网站。借助Vue的响应式特性,网站可以自动根据用户的操作实时更新内容,提升用户体验和互动性。

步骤一:搭建开发环境

要开始开发Vue网站,首先需要搭建一个合适的开发环境。你可以选择安装Node.js和npm(Node Package Manager),以便能够运行和管理Vue项目所需的工具和依赖。接下来,使用npm安装Vue的命令行工具(Vue CLI),该工具可以帮助你快速创建、开发和打包Vue项目。

步骤二:了解Vue的基本概念

在开始实际开发之前,你需要对Vue的基本概念有一定的了解。Vue使用组件化的开发方式,将页面拆分成多个可重用的组件,每个组件包含自己的模板、脚本和样式。理解Vue的实例、生命周期钩子、数据绑定和指令等概念,对于开发响应式网站至关重要。

步骤三:编写Vue组件

现在开始动手编写Vue组件吧!首先,创建一个根组件,并定义其模板。在模板中,你可以使用Vue提供的模板语法和指令来动态地渲染和绑定数据。接着,定义组件的脚本,包括数据、方法和生命周期钩子等。最后,样式部分可以使用CSS或CSS预处理器来美化组件的外观。

步骤四:处理用户交互

一个优秀的网站不仅仅要具备良好的外观,还要有灵活的用户交互。Vue提供了丰富的指令和事件系统,可以轻松处理用户的点击、滚动、输入等交互操作。通过监听事件、绑定数据和调用方法,你可以实现各种交互功能,例如表单验证、动态加载数据和实时更新页面。

步骤五:优化性能

在开发响应式网站的过程中,性能优化是一项重要任务。Vue提供了一系列优化技巧,帮助你提升网站的加载速度和响应性能。例如,使用Vue的异步组件和懒加载功能可以延迟加载页面的一部分,减少首屏加载时间。另外,合理使用Vue的虚拟DOM和组件缓存等机制,也可以减少不必要的DOM操作,提升网站的性能。

步骤六:部署和发布

完成开发后,现在是时候将网站部署到服务器并发布给用户了。首先,你需要选择一个合适的托管服务商,并将代码上传到服务器。然后,配置服务器环境,确保网站能够正常运行。最后,使用Vue CLI提供的打包工具将代码打包成生产环境所需的静态文件,并进行必要的优化,以保证网站在生产环境中的性能和稳定性。

通过以上六个步骤,你可以轻松地使用Vue开发响应式网站。无论是个人博客、电子商务网站还是企业官网,Vue都能帮助你打造出令人印象深刻的网站。开始你的Vue之旅吧,享受开发的乐趣和成果!

首页

电话